titleOfInvention | Method for handling solid low-radioactivity wastes |
abstract | FIELD: handling solid wastes. SUBSTANCE: method includes treatment of solid wastes to bring them to specific activity for their limited use, bifurcation of limited-use solid waste flow, first being total flow having corpuscular specific waste activity between lower level of limited-use specific-activity wastes to 15% of upper level of limited-use specific-activity solid wastes; second flow has specific-activity level between 15 and 100% from upper level of specific-activity limited-use solid wastes. First-flow wastes are placed in reservoir made of water-tight material; second-flow wastes are disposed in reservoir made of material insulating them from environment. Limited-use solid wastes are stored on disposal ground for industrial wastes. EFFECT: enhanced safety in handling radioactive wastes; reduced cost of their storage. 5 cl, 6 ex |
